Question #72597
How many atoms are in a 250 g sample of Gold?

A. 1.19 × 1023 atoms
B. 1.19 × 1026 atoms
C. 7.65 × 1022 atoms
D. 7.65 × 1024 atoms
E. None of the Above

m(Au)=250 g
n(Au)=m/M=250g/197g/mol = 1,27 moles
N=n•Na
N(Au) = 1,27•6,02•1023 = 7,65•1023 atoms
E. None of the Above
